A multinational corporation is conducting a study to see how its employees in five different countries respond to three gifts in an incentive scheme. The numbers of employees who choose each of the three gifts (G1 to G3) in each of the five countries (A to E) are given in the table in ‘Dataset6’ in the Excel document. 1. Set up the structure of an appropriate statistical test to determine whether the data supports a link between choice of gift and country, including the statistic to be used. 2. Carry out this test, showing clearly in your work how the expected values are calculated for your test statistic.   G1 G2 G3 A 5 17 19 B 8 20 19 C 11 16 25 D 12 19 30 E 13 20 28
